Powder Induction and Dispersion System Market Size

The Powder Induction and Dispersion System Market was valued at USD 1,058.7 million in 2024 and is projected to reach USD 1,108.4 million in 2025, growing to USD 1,600.6 million by 2033, with a CAGR of 4.7% from 2025 to 2033.

The US Powder Induction and Dispersion System Market is growing steadily, driven by increasing demand in industries such as pharmaceuticals, food processing, and chemicals. Technological advancements in powder handling and dispersion processes are further fueling market expansion.

The Powder Induction and Dispersion System market is witnessing rapid growth driven by increasing demand for efficient powder handling solutions in various industries such as chemicals, food & beverage, pharmaceuticals, and cosmetics. These systems ensure faster and more uniform dispersion of powders into liquids, addressing issues like clumping and inconsistent mixtures. The need for automation in manufacturing processes, along with a rise in demand for high-quality products, has led to the growing adoption of powder induction systems. Technological advancements, such as the integration of smart monitoring systems and energy-efficient designs, further enhance the appeal of these solutions.

Segmentation Analysis

The Powder Induction and Dispersion System market is segmented based on type and application. By type, the market is divided into continuous process and batch process systems. These two segments address different manufacturing needs, with each offering its own set of advantages in terms of efficiency and flexibility. By application, the market caters to various industries, including food & beverages, pharmaceuticals, cosmetics and personal care, and chemicals. These industries require different powder dispersion systems to meet their specific production needs, ranging from high-volume manufacturing to precision ingredient mixing. Understanding the segmentation is critical as it helps in identifying key market drivers and growth areas across different sectors.

By Type

  • Continuous Process: The continuous process segment is gaining popularity due to its efficiency in high-volume manufacturing. Approximately 55% of the market is driven by continuous process systems, particularly in industries like food & beverages and chemicals. These systems allow for the seamless addition of powders into liquids without interrupting the production flow. This ensures higher throughput and reduces downtime, which is essential in industries requiring large-scale production. Continuous systems are often preferred in processes where consistency and uniformity are key, such as in beverage production.

  • Batch Process: Batch process systems account for around 45% of the market. These systems are typically used when flexibility is required in production runs, especially in industries like pharmaceuticals and cosmetics, where product formulations can vary between batches. While batch processes may not provide the same level of continuous throughput as continuous systems, they allow for more precise control over smaller batches of mixed products. This is critical for maintaining high-quality standards, particularly in sensitive applications like pharmaceutical production.

By Application

  • Food & Beverages: The food & beverages sector is a significant application area, contributing around 38% of the market demand. Companies in this industry require efficient powder induction and dispersion systems to incorporate ingredients like sugar, flavoring agents, and thickeners into liquids. The need for consistency, flavor uniformity, and texture in food products drives the adoption of advanced dispersion systems. As the demand for ready-to-eat and processed foods rises, the need for these systems continues to increase.

  • Pharmaceuticals: Pharmaceuticals hold a substantial portion of the market, around 30%, driven by the need for high-precision in powder formulation. Powder induction and dispersion systems are crucial for creating uniform drug formulations, ensuring consistent dosages in tablets, capsules, and syrups. These systems are particularly essential in the production of solid dosage forms, where the uniform distribution of active ingredients is critical to product safety and efficacy.

  • Cosmetic and Personal Care Products: The cosmetic and personal care industry accounts for approximately 18% of the market. In this sector, powder dispersion systems are used for products such as creams, lotions, and makeup powders. Consistent texture, smooth application, and even distribution of ingredients are crucial for consumer satisfaction and regulatory compliance, which boosts the adoption of powder induction systems.

  • Chemicals: The chemicals industry makes up around 14% of the market. In this sector, powder dispersion systems are used to blend powders into liquids for the production of paints, coatings, and other chemical products. The need for efficient, consistent mixing in these applications drives the demand for advanced powder induction systems, especially in large-scale industrial production.

Technological Advancements

Technological advancements in the Powder Induction and Dispersion System market have been critical in enhancing the efficiency and precision of industrial mixing processes. Automation has become a key trend, with systems now capable of operating with minimal human intervention, increasing production speeds and reducing errors. About 35% of companies in this sector are adopting fully automated systems to improve overall production efficiency. Furthermore, advancements in smart technologies are providing real-time monitoring and control, which is expected to improve performance in industries like food processing and pharmaceuticals. For instance, systems that integrate IoT (Internet of Things) technology allow for continuous feedback on powder dispersion consistency, a key feature for quality control. Additionally, energy-efficient dispersion systems have gained traction, accounting for nearly 30% of new installations. These systems not only enhance operational efficiency but also reduce energy consumption by up to 15%, helping companies meet sustainability goals. Innovations in system design, such as the development of compact models that require less floor space, are further revolutionizing the market, providing flexibility and scalability for industries of all sizes.
